Question : Which of the following is an assumption made while drawing the demand curve
a:The demand curve must be linear
b:The price of substitutes should not change
c: The quantity demanded should not change
d: The price of the commodity should not change
Option 1: A and B
Option 2: B only
Option 3: A, B and C only
Option 4: A, B, C and D all
Answer (1)
Correct Answer: B only
Solution : Prices of substitutes should not change is the assumption of law of demand.
The assumption behind a demand curve or a supply curve is that no relevant economic factors, other than the product's price, are changing.
Hence only b is the correct answer.
